WebIDE icon indicating copy to clipboard operation
WebIDE copied to clipboard

如何看待 sourcegraph 采用 vscode 而非 atom ?

Open transtone opened this issue 8 years ago • 13 comments

https://sourcegraph.com/github.com/Coding/WebIDE-Frontend@master/-/blob/app/index.js WebIDE也做同样的转变,专注于后端是否更有效率?

transtone avatar May 09 '17 07:05 transtone

@transtone Thanks for sharing. 但是我没太看明白你的问题?意思是你建议 WebIDE 的 UI 也走 vscode 的风格?

hackape avatar May 15 '17 07:05 hackape

当年话没说清楚,发个帖子就没管了。其实意思是 sourcegraph 都放弃自己的 atom 改用 vscode 了,还抱着 WebIDE 干啥。 看到现今 cloud studio 放弃 WebIDE 而使用 vscode remote,有些小感概。

transtone avatar Oct 20 '19 12:10 transtone

同样的感慨。

xunfeng1980 avatar Oct 21 '19 03:10 xunfeng1980

vscode 确实牛逼,不服不行

hackape avatar Oct 21 '19 08:10 hackape

当年 github 为了做 atom 才搞出了 electron,结果到头来 M$ 用 electron 做了 vscode 把 atom 干翻了 当年 coding 还在主营 git 托管业务,在努力开拓“码市”业务,WebIDE 是作为一个锦上添花的副业由上海的六人团队独立在开发,结果主业都不温不火,最后被腾讯云收编的时候 WebIDE 反倒是最被爸爸看重的那块业务 值得感慨的事情挺多的……

hackape avatar Oct 21 '19 09:10 hackape

@hackape 多年不见,现在已经直接基于vscode开发了么?

summershrimp avatar Oct 22 '19 06:10 summershrimp

@summershrimp 我离开了好久了,不是我做的。看样子现在是用 vscode 魔改的,具体怎么改、有没有加功能不清楚呢

hackape avatar Oct 22 '19 07:10 hackape

是我们搞的,然鹅现在也不做了,有兴趣来阿里做IDE的吗

Aaaaash avatar Oct 22 '19 07:10 Aaaaash

现在阿里的是不是基于Theia做的 我看新版本的好像是的

502647092 avatar Oct 22 '19 07:10 502647092

Theia 也是基于vscode 代码做的吧

summershrimp avatar Oct 22 '19 08:10 summershrimp

Theia 只采用了 monaco editor,其他的包括主要 ui 界面和命令、插件系统,都是他们自己另外写的

hackape avatar Oct 22 '19 09:10 hackape

我看阿里云函数服务里面用的就是Theia改版的

502647092 avatar Oct 22 '19 11:10 502647092

阿里有很多IDE

Aaaaash avatar Oct 22 '19 14:10 Aaaaash